Original Description
Takeshiro Kanokogi's Landscape is a mesmerizing fusion of Eastern sensibility and Western painting techniques, embodying the artist's pivotal role in Japan's Meiji-era (1868-1912) artistic modernization. This evocative work captures nature's tranquility through layered brushstrokes that suggest mist-clad mountains or serene waterways, blending traditional Japanese ink-wash aesthetics with European-style perspective. Kanokogi, among the first Japanese artists to study in Paris, bridges ukiyo-e's flat elegance and Impressionism's luminous depth—a stylistic hybrid that positioned him as a cultural conduit during Japan's opening to the West. The painting's hazy, dreamlike quality reflects both nihonga reverence for atmospheric nuance and Monet-esque light studies, making it a significant artifact in transnational art history. Its subdued yet dynamic composition exemplifies how Japanese artists reinterpreted Western conventions while preserving spiritual connections to nature.
